About 2-AMINO-3,5-DIBROMO

2-AMINO-3,5-DIBROMO BENZALDEHYDE [ADBA]

FORMULA: C7H5Br2NO

MOL. Wt.: 278.93   g/mole

CAS NO.: 50910-55-9

Appearance: Yellow Colour crystalline powder.

SOLUBILITY: Soluble in Tetra hydro furan.

MELTING POINT: 137ºC to 140ºC.

ASSAY: Between 98.0 to 102.0 % w/w.

PACKING: HDPE. Drums
25 Kgs/50 Kgs as required by the customer.

STORAGE: Store in tightly closed containers at Ambient temperature.                                      



Applications and Benefits

2-Amino-3,5-dibromobenzoic acid serves as an important precursor in organic synthesis, particularly in the pharmaceutical industry. Its stability and high purity make it ideal for research and development in laboratory settings. The compound is mainly utilized for synthesizing advanced pharmaceuticals and specialty chemicals, offering reliability and efficiency in chemical processes.


Safe Handling and Storage Guidelines

For optimal preservation, store the product in a cool, dry, and well-ventilated area, away from incompatible substances. Although non-poisonous, users should avoid contact with eyes, skin, and clothing, and ensure adequate ventilation when handling. The material is stable, non-hygroscopic, and maintains its quality when following recommended storage practices, backed by a shelf life of 36 months.


Packaging and Transportation

2-Amino-3,5-dibromobenzoic acid is distributed in HDPE drums, fiber drums, or double-layer PE bags, ensuring product integrity. It is not classified as hazardous for transport and carries no UN number, facilitating easy domestic and international shipping. Its compliance with industry standards guarantees safe and secure handling during transit.
